Trading as a pedlar
The Pedlars Act 1871 requires pedlars to apply to the Chief Constable of their local police force for a pedlar's certificate. Trading as a pedlar without a certificate is an offence. The Pedlars Act 1871 defines a pedlar as a person who trades by travelling on foot between town to town or visits another persons' house. SpletPeddling. Peddling is different to a street trading activity, which requires a street trading consent. A pedlar is: A pedestrian; Someone who trades whilst travelling rather than travelling to trade; and. Someone who goes to customers rather than allowing them to come to the pedlar. A peddler and a hawker both sell things, both might use a spiel to do so, and both are itinerant.My impression of the difference is that a peddler carries his merchandise around, so his selling activities take place in varied circumstances — the … Splet18. dec. 2013 · A pedlar’s means of trading must be mobile and movable so as not to cause obstruction or public liability on the highway. A pedlar may use a pedestrian scale mobile device to carry and display goods. A pedlars is also described as a hawker amongst other descriptions. A pedlar is entitled to remain static whilst serving customers.
